The Global Commercial & Industrial Status of Powder Coating Touch-Ups

Analyzing the global paradigm shift towards sustainable coating repair systems, architectural maintenance, and chemical compatibility metrics.

In modern industrial manufacturing and global construction, structural components, outdoor furniture, two-wheelers, and automotive body parts are subjected to intensive handling, transportation, and harsh environmental exposure. While powder coating offers unparalleled durability, surface damage—in the form of micro-scratches, edge chipping, and transport abrasions—is statistically inevitable. Historically, correcting these flaws required total stripping and re-coating, an energy-intensive and cost-prohibitive process.

Today, the technology of touching up powder coat surfaces has evolved from cosmetic cover-ups to a highly specialized repair science. Global industrial sectors now require touch-up solutions that chemically align with the original powder thermosetting matrix (polyester, polyurethane, epoxy-polyester hybrids, or acrylics). Delivering a touch-up coating that mirrors the gloss, texture, and corrosion resistance of the factory-cured electrostatic finish is crucial to preserving structural integrity and preventing premature oxidation.

The global demand for high-grade touch-up coatings has spiked, driven by the expansion of infrastructure projects, commercial architectural metal works, and logistics hubs. Multi-billion dollar industries now integrate touch-up protocols directly into their Quality Assurance (QA) standards. The goal is simple: achieve seamless aesthetic matching while maintaining environmental compliance, specifically meeting EU RoHS standards and reducing Volatile Organic Compound (VOC) emissions during maintenance phases.

Frequently Asked Questions & Technical Insights

Technical answers to common questions about powder coating repair, application methods, and color matching.

1. Can you touch up a cured powder coat finish with liquid paint?
Yes, using specialized liquid touch-up paints is the standard industry method for fixing minor scratches and transit damage. Since fully cured powder coatings are chemical-resistant, it is not practical to apply a second layer of electrostatic powder and bake the entire part again without stripping it. A compatible acrylic, polyurethane, or epoxy-liquid paint is used to match the gloss, color, and texture of the original cured powder.

3. What surface preparation is required before applying a touch-up coating?
Proper adhesion requires thorough surface preparation. The damaged area must be free of oils, dust, rust, and moisture. Clean the area with a mild solvent like isopropyl alcohol. Smooth down rough edges around the chip with fine sandpaper (400-600 grit) to create a clean profile before applying the touch-up product.

5. What is the typical shelf life of powder coatings, and how should they be stored?
Standard polyester and epoxy-polyester powder coatings have a shelf life of approximately 12 months when stored in their original sealed boxes at temperatures below 25°C (77°F) and relative humidity levels below 60%. Keep the powder away from direct sunlight, moisture, and high temperatures to prevent clumping.
